@ttk/component
Version:
ttk组件库
42 lines (32 loc) • 1.35 kB
JavaScript
;
Object.defineProperty(exports, '__esModule', { value: true });
var _extends = require('../extends-63327b06.js');
var defineProperty = require('../defineProperty-ad97b418.js');
var React = require('react');
var antd = require('antd');
var classNames = require('classnames');
require('../_commonjsHelpers-badc9712.js');
function _interopDefaultLegacy (e) { return e && typeof e === 'object' && 'default' in e ? e : { 'default': e }; }
var React__default = /*#__PURE__*/_interopDefaultLegacy(React);
var classNames__default = /*#__PURE__*/_interopDefaultLegacy(classNames);
function MenuComponent(props) {
var className = classNames__default["default"](defineProperty._defineProperty({
'mk-menu': true
}, props.className, !!props.className));
return /*#__PURE__*/React__default["default"].createElement(antd.Menu, _extends._extends({}, props, {
className: className
}));
}
/**
* antd新版本使用popupClassName
*/
function SubMenuComponent(props) {
return /*#__PURE__*/React__default["default"].createElement(antd.Menu.SubMenu, _extends._extends({}, props, {
popupClassName: props.className
}));
}
MenuComponent.Divider = antd.Menu.Divider;
MenuComponent.Item = antd.Menu.Item;
MenuComponent.SubMenu = SubMenuComponent;
MenuComponent.ItemGroup = antd.Menu.ItemGroup;
exports["default"] = MenuComponent;